What does a Junior Python Backend Developer do?

A Junior Python Backend Developer is responsible for writing server-side logic using the Python programming language. They work on building, maintaining, and optimizing the backend of web applications, often collaborating with frontend developers and other team members. Their daily tasks may include developing APIs, managing databases, debugging code, and ensuring the application runs smoothly and efficiently. As junior developers, they are also expected to learn best practices, follow coding standards, and continuously improve their sk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Junior Python Backend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Junior Python Backend Developer, you need proficiency in Python programming, understanding of backend frameworks like Django or Flask, and a solid grasp of databases and RESTful API design, typically supported by a relevant degree or coding bootcamp experience.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, cloud platforms, and containerization tools such as Docker is often expected. Strong problem-solving skills, eagerness to learn, and effective teamwork make someone stand out in this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for building reliable backend systems, collaborating with teams, and adapting to evolving technical requirements.

What types of projects and tasks can a Junior Python Backend Developer expect to work on during their first year?

As a Junior Python Backend Developer, you can expect to work on tasks such as building and maintaining RESTful APIs, writing automated tests, fixing bugs, and contributing to database design. You'll likely start with smaller components or features, collaborating closely with senior developers and front-end teams to ensure smooth data flow and application performance. Over time, you'll gain exposure to code reviews, deployment processes, and may gradually take on more complex assignments as you build your expertise and confidence.
